Wall Street Journal:
Montana Governor Greg Gianforte signs the country's first bill that bans TikTok in a state, set to go into effect on January 1, 2024  —  Ban is slated to take effect next year—if it survives expected litigation  —  Montana's governor signed the country's first bill that outright bans TikTok …
Huw Jones / Reuters:
A UK Treasury Committee crypto report recommends the government regulate trading and investment in unbacked crypto as gambling instead of a financial service  —  Bitcoin , ether and other cryptocurrencies should be regulated as gambling given the significant risks they pose to consumers …
Suvashree Ghosh / Bloomberg:
Binance Australia can no longer offer Aussie dollar deposits due to a decision by Cuscal, “our payment processor's partner bank”, and warns of disruptions  —  The Australian arm of crypto exchange Binance suffered a setback on Thursday after the local platform lost access …

Michelle Faverio / Pew Research Center:
Survey: 60% of Americans who used Twitter in the past year have taken a break from the social network; 25% say they are not likely to use Twitter in a year  —  A majority of Americans who have used Twitter in the past year report taking a break from the platform during that time …
Mark Gurman / Bloomberg:
Sources detail Apple's headset ahead of WWDC: a shift from a vision of eyeglasses to ski goggles, Tim Cook's design noninvolvement, selling at cost, and more  —  Many times throughout its history, Apple Inc. has redefined consumer technology by breathing new life into an existing category …
CoinDesk:
Grayscale says the US SEC warned that the Filecoin token meets the definition of a security and asked Grayscale to withdraw its Filecoin Trust application  —  Grayscale announced last month that the SEC suggested FIL might be a security.  —  to withdraw its Form 10 that sought …
Tatum Hunter / Washington Post:
Ovulation tracking app Premom agrees to pay $200K to settle with the FTC and state AGs for allegedly sharing user information with third parties without consent  —  The app allegedly shared sensitive user information with China-based companies known for privacy problems
Financial Times:
At a meeting with Japan's Prime Minister, TSMC, Samsung, Intel, Micron, and other chipmakers announce plans to expand investment and partnerships in the country  —  Seven of the world's largest semiconductor makers have set out plans to increase manufacturing and deepen tech partnerships …
Laura Cole / Wired:
An investigation reveals how hundreds of freelancers hired as customer service reps catfish users into paying for subscriptions on niche dating and hookup sites  —  Hired as customer service reps, these freelancers were instead tasked with luring in the lonely and lovestruck through a network of dating and hookup sites.
Manish Singh / TechCrunch:
AWS plans to invest $12.7B into its infrastructure in India by 2030, in addition to a previous $3.7B, and says its spending will support 131,700 full-time jobs  —  Amazon plans to invest $12.7 billion into its cloud infrastructure in India by 2030, the e-commerce group said Thursday …
Alex Weprin / The Hollywood Reporter:
Netflix says its ad tier has nearly 5M MAUs globally six months after launch and makes up 25%+ of signups in countries with the option; the median age is 34  —  In its inaugural upfront advertising event, executives touted the the streaming service's growing ad tier, and unveiled new sponsorship options.
Yogita Khatri / The Block:
Tether plans to invest up to 15% of its profits in bitcoin, as the stablecoin developer shifts its reserves toward crypto and away from US government debt  —  - Tether is set to purchase bitcoin on a regular basis from its profits.  — It held $1.5 billion in bitcoin as of the end of the first quarter …
Washington Post:
A survey of 70 cybersecurity experts: 64% favor reauthorization of FISA's Section 702, set to expire at the end of 2023, with some changes to address abuse  —  Welcome to The Cybersecurity 202!  It's good to be back from Denver.  There, a 6-year-old repeatedly defeated me and/or incapacitated …

Diana Li / Bloomberg:
Grammarly announces Grammarly Business, which uses generative AI to summarize key points in email threads, compose replies, and more, rolling out in June 2023  —  Grammarly Inc., a software company known for its writing assistant, is trying to expand its business to the office by harnessing artificial intelligence.
